Join Chesapeake Oncology Hematology Associates as a Medical Assistant Instructor, where you will play a vital role in patient care by escorting patients, assisting with procedures, and training other staff. Your professionalism and customer service skills will shine in a collaborative environment focused on patient-centered care.
Key Responsibilities
Escort patients to and from the exam room and complete patient intake
Clean and straighten exam room between patients
Prepare syringes and administer injections
Assist provider with injectable procedures
Prepare and route pathology and lab specimens
Respond to patient questions in office and via phone
Schedule or re-schedule appointments as necessary
Comply with OSHA and HIPAA standards
Maintain medication samples and discard out-of-date supplies
Train other employees on medical assistant duties
Assist with check-in or check-out procedures at the front desk
Perform additional duties as required
Required Qualifications
At least one year of medical assisting experience
Completion of a Medical Assistant or Certified Nursing Assistant program
Professionalism and strong customer service skills
Ability to communicate clearly with doctors and patients
Ability to lift at least 15 pounds
Ability to stand for prolonged periods
